    I'm not the biggest classic book fan. There are some I like, but most of the ones I've read are either boring, confusing, or hard to read, sometimes all three at once. Can you recommend a classic that I might like? I like all genres except historical fiction

      Animal Farm by George Orwell. It’s short and I think the message is fairly clear. Not a lot of names to remember (looking at you, Catch-22) and lots of study guides online since it’s heavily read in high school English classes

      Depends what sort of books you like.

      War: All Quiet On The Western Front is a classic, easy read and wow!

      Horror: Frankenstein, Dracula

      Fantasy: Lord of the Rings. If you find that hard, cheat and watch the movies first.

      Charles Dickens – Oliver Twist. (Orphans, crime, the terrible life in mid 19th century England)

      William Golding – Lord of the Flies. (Boys on desert Island descend into violence)

      Eleanor Atkinson – Greyfriars Bobby (Dog tale)

      Kidnapped by Robert Louis Stevenson (Adventure)

      None are especially hard to read.
